- Statement
- These data contain 12 sets (4 model configurations x 3 temperature pathways) of annual model output from JULES driven by 34 different GCM climate patterns as described in the IMOGEN system. The four model configurations included are: - 'BLco' - Baseline, or control, configuration without methane feedback. - 'CH4_lowQ10' - CH4 feedback configuration with a low temperature sensitivity methanogenesis scheme. - 'CH4_poorFEN' - CH4 feedback configuration with a methanogenesis temperature sensitivity representative of 'poor fen' type wetlands. - 'CH4_richFEN' - CH4 feedback configuration with a methanogenesis temperature sensitivity representative of 'rich fen' type wetlands. The three temperature scenarios included are: - '2deg' - Stabilisation at 2 deg C by 2100 from below - '1p5deg' - Stabilisation at 1.5 deg C by 2100 from below - '1p5degOS' - Stabilisation at 1.5 deg C by 2100 following an overshoot to 1.75 deg C For full details of the methods used please refer to Comyn-Platt et al. (2018) https://doi.org/10.1038/s41561-018-0174-9
